Photoprotective effect of a psoralen-UVA-induced tan.
Gschnait F, Brenner W, Wolff K.
Abstract
To determine whether a tan produced by 8-MOP and UVA protects from subsequent solar light irradiation, volunteers 

were irradiated with unfiltered Xenon arc light before and 10 days after a 1 week's course of four 8-MOP-UVA 

treatments. Evaluation of the minimal erythema doses and of histological changes before and after 8-MOP-UVA 

treatment revealed that the 8-MOP-UVA induced tan protected against the erythemogenic and cell damaging effects of 

Xenon arc light. Unscheduled repair DNA synthesis, used as a measure for UVB-induced DNA damage and repair, was 

also investigated in skin irradiated with the Xenon arc before and after 8-MOP-UVA induced tanning. Both the number 

of grains per sparse labeled cell and the number of sparse labeled cells per 1000 cells, were found to be 

significantly lower in tanned skin; taking decreased unschedules repair DNA synthesis as a measure for decreased 

DNA-damage, these findings also demonstrate a photoprotective effect of the 8--MOP-UVA induced tan.
